Inspector Beaton was shot three times, including serious wounds in the chest and abdomen, and a gunshot wound to his hand, sustained when he tried to block Ball's weapon with his own body, after his own gun had jammed. In 1982 he became the Queen's Police Officer. He retired in 1992.
